Iphone 获取已播放电影的当前位置(MPMoviePlayerController currentPlaybackTime不工作)

Iphone 获取已播放电影的当前位置(MPMoviePlayerController currentPlaybackTime不工作),iphone,mpmovieplayercontroller,Iphone,Mpmovieplayercontroller,希望有人能给我一个答案——我现在搜索了几个小时。 我想得到一个电影的职位 我用MPMoviePlayerController尝试过,但是这个类不支持名为“currentPlaybackTime”的MPMediaPlayback属性。 (有趣的是,MPMusicPlayerController具有此属性) 因此,我无法在视频中获得该位置。还有别的方法吗 提前非常感谢 MPMoviePlayerController符合MPMediaPlayback协议,并且具有可用的currentPlaybackT

希望有人能给我一个答案——我现在搜索了几个小时。 我想得到一个电影的职位

我用MPMoviePlayerController尝试过,但是这个类不支持名为“currentPlaybackTime”的MPMediaPlayback属性。 (有趣的是,MPMusicPlayerController具有此属性)

因此,我无法在视频中获得该位置。还有别的方法吗


提前非常感谢

MPMoviePlayerController符合MPMediaPlayback协议,并且具有可用的currentPlaybackTime属性。但是,我相信currentPlaybackTime属性是在3.2中引入的,因此如果您试图在3.2之前的设备上开发,则可能无法使用它。

您好,谢谢您的回答。我正在开发iOS 4.1。MPMoviePlayerController符合MPMediaPlayback协议,但不包括currentPlaybackTime属性!这就是问题所在:-(。或者我必须自己实现它吗?忘记我最后的评论。MPMoviePlayerController和属性“currentPlaybackTime”是正确的方法,即使它显然不是作为属性写入MPMoviePlayerController.h文件中…我现在将时间以秒为单位作为浮点值。它没有显示在MPMoviePlayerController.h文件中,因为它在协议中。您可以将其视为继承…MPMoviePlayerController是MPMediaPlayback对象。这意味着它继承(在本例中实现)MPMediaPlayBack协议所需的所有属性。